Clay & Buck zero in on the places where Democrats were washed away by the Red Wave, chief among them, the state of Florida, where Governor Ron DeSantis won by a landslide.
This is a stunning statistic. DeSantis has turned the Sunshine State red.
Our man, Senator Ron Johnson, also held on for a third term.
There were also some ripples of the Red Wave in the House.
The Senate had bright spots, chief among them in Ohio, and although they’re close, it looks like Nevada is still in play and Georgia’s Herschel Walker is headed to a runoff in December.
